real estate investmentsHouses are going for such good prices these days, and interest rates are so low. Maybe it’s time to invest in residential real estate to provide extra money during your retirement years

Before you invest, it’s important to determine a reasonable estimate of the property’s income potential. For property that is already being leased, it’s easy enough to request documents that will show how much the property earns, how much it costs to maintain, and whether or not it has a history of being occupied consistently.

Residents of Soleil Laurel Canyon and their family members gathered in the Soleil clubhouse on Saturday, May 15 for a Pancake Breakfast Fundraiser in the name of a good cause. The fundraiser, held by Soleil Laurel Canyon’s Veteran’s Club, raised $2,200 that will help support active military, Veterans and their families throughout Cherokee County and Northwest Georgia areas.

Mementos such as military uniforms and pictures from previous eras of Veterans lined the halls of the clubhouse while Cherokee High School’s Air Force Junior ROTC color guard and drill team performed the Presentation of Colors, Pledge of Allegiance and national anthem.  George Bernard, president of Soleil Laurel Canyon’s Veteran’s Club, deemed the event as “outstanding” and praised the outcome as a huge success.
